Louisiana is well-known for its frequent and intense thunderstorms.

On average, the state experiences around 60 to 70 thunderstorms annually, more than most other states in the U.S.

The proximity to the Gulf of Mexico plays a significant role in this phenomenon, as warm, moist air from the gulf fuels severe weather conditions.

Climate change and global warming are also contributing factors to the increasing frequency and severity of thunderstorms in Louisiana.

Warmer temperatures lead to more energy in the atmosphere, which can result in stronger storm systems.

These powerful storms often lead to property damage and, unfortunately, can be deadly.

Thunderstorm Climatology in Louisiana

Louisiana experiences frequent thunderstorms due to its location near the Gulf of Mexico. These storms can be intense and bring various hazards such as lightning, hail, and occasionally tornadoes.

Frequency and Seasonality

Thunderstorms in Louisiana are common year-round, but they peak during the warmer months.

Meteorologists note that the state sees an average of around 60 to 70 thunderstorm days annually.

The Gulf of Mexico‘s proximity contributes to the regular influx of warm, moist air, which fuels these storms.

Both Doppler radar and satellite technology help researchers track storm patterns and predict their occurrence with greater accuracy.

Types of Thunderstorms and Hazards

Louisiana experiences several types of thunderstorms ranging from common thunderstorms to severe thunderstorms.

Severe storms often bring lightning, hail, and flash flooding.

Tornadoes, although less frequent, can also occur.

The data provided by radar systems is crucial for issuing timely warnings and minimizing potential damage.

The most dangerous thunderstorms can produce significant damage and pose severe risks to life and property.

By analyzing thunderstorm patterns, experts aim to improve forecasting capabilities and enhance preparedness measures throughout the region.

Assessing Storm-Related Damage

Louisiana, situated along the Gulf Coast, is prone to severe weather events. Thunderstorms in this region can bring heavy rain and strong winds.

This often results in roof damage, broken windows, and flooding. Coastal cities like New Orleans experience flash floods due to storm surges and overwhelmed drainage systems.

Assessing damage quickly is crucial. The National Weather Service provides real-time updates and lead time estimates, which helps in preparation.

Local agencies and residents are advised to check for structural damage, electrical hazards, and road conditions post-storm. This quick assessment can prevent further injury and help in efficient recovery efforts.

For mitigation, installing lightning rods and using storm shutters can protect homes. Building regulations in tornado alley regions now include stronger standards to withstand storms.

Communities should invest in flood defenses and infrastructure improvements to handle increased rainfall and climate change impacts.
